Can a colon cleanse hurt your kidneys?

Although the reports show little evidence of any benefit, many studies reported side effects. These include cramping, bloating, nausea, vomiting, electrolyte imbalance, and kidney failure. Some herbal preparations have been linked with liver toxicity and aplastic anemia, she says.

How much weight can you lose from colon cleanse?

There’s also no evidence that a colon cleanse can cause meaningful weight loss. A cleanse may help a person lose a few pounds initially, but that is a temporary loss, resulting from the removal of water weight and stool, and not from a permanent loss of fat.

Does diarrhea clean out your colon?

Your Colon Is Never Empty Many people believe that they have emptied out their colons after multiple bouts of diarrhea or that they can keep their colon empty by avoiding food. However, since stool is made up in large part of bacteria, fecal matter is continuously being formed.

What are the side effects of colon cleanse pills?

There are some potential risks and side effects, including: Dehydration. Vomiting, nausea, cramps. Dizziness, a sign of dehydration. Mineral imbalance. Electrolyte imbalance. Bacterial imbalance and infection. Potential interference with medication absorption on day of procedure. Bowel perforation.

Can you be backed up and still poop?

Can You Be Constipated and Still Poop? Yes. It’s possible that you can be constipated, yet still have bowel movements. Constipation is typically defined as having fewer than three bowel movements a week.

Can you really detox your body?

Some people report feeling more focused and energetic during and after detox diets. However, there’s little evidence that detox diets actually remove toxins from the body. Indeed, the kidneys and liver are generally quite effective at filtering and eliminating most ingested toxins.
